Transaction ec335a722791008fea692767e421faa4c500d4d8eeee3da2b0aed1fad743444d
1 Input
1 Output
-
ec335a722791008fea692767e421faa4c500d4d8eeee3da2b0aed1fad743444d:0
- value
- 408573
- script pubkey
- OP_0 OP_PUSHBYTES_20 302f0ba389f192f0dfdf40250056f0a92ddc5fe0
- address
- bc1qxqhshguf7xf0ph7lgqjsq4hs4ykachlqkydkzl